WebMar 25, 2024 · The names for October (octo), November (novem), and December (decem) suggest that they would be the eighth, ninth, and tenth months. And they once were, when the Roman lunar calendar started the year in March at harvest time. Latin Junius mensis "month of Juno". Junius had 30 days, until Numa when it had 29 days, until Julius when it became 30 days long. Juno is the principle goddess of the Roman Pantheon. She is the goddess of marriage and the well-being of women.
